微小隐孢子虫表面抗原CP23DNA疫苗免疫山羊诱导免疫应答及保护性研究

摘    要:观察微小隐孢子虫(Cryptosporidium parvum)子孢子表面抗原CP 23 DNA疫苗免疫山羊诱导其产生免疫应答和保护性作用。将重组质粒pCR3.1-23经鼻粘免疫怀孕山羊,用ELISA测定IgG和IgA抗体滴度,用C.parvum卵囊经口对其后代攻虫感染。抗CP23抗体存在于免疫山羊的血浆和初乳中,且抗体滴度随免疫时间延长而增高。C.parvum卵囊经口感染后代,试验组山羊后代与对照组相比,卵囊排出数量减少,排出时间缩短,微小隐孢子虫表面蛋白CP 23 DNA疫苗能诱导山羊产生特异性免疫应答并对其后代有一定免疫保护作用。

The Protective Immune Responses Induced by CP 23 DNA Vaccine of Cryptosporidium parvum in Goats

Abstract:To observe the protective immune responses induced by the CP23 DNA vaccine of C.parvum in goats.Large scale preparation of the recombinant plasmids pCR3.1 23 was inoculated by nasal mucosa of conceived goats.The IgG and IgA antibodies in serum and colostrum were detected by enzyme linked immunosorbent assay(ELISA).The lambs of vaccinated goats were challenged by oocysts of C.parvum .The specific IgG and IgA antibodies in serum and colostrum from vaccinated goated could be detected and the titer of IgG and IgA gradually rose with time prolong.The oocysts number and shedding time of the lambs from vaccinated goats were shorter than of control groups after lambs were challenged with oocysts of C.parvum .The CP23 DNA vaccine of C.parvum could elicit immune responses against C.parvum oocysts.
